Output 8408229c3e848639c61081c42b59a836c7f80ae1c9a84f98b11f34080eca1278:0

value
22928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3a10a3b7ee7fccf59a52d4130f35e178590a852 OP_EQUAL
address
3PuD3QqhceRb93uZtwW2wyyKxUM9RrdacW
transaction
8408229c3e848639c61081c42b59a836c7f80ae1c9a84f98b11f34080eca1278